Molecular Genetic Characterization of the Diet of Limestone and Rainforest Langurs
Using DNA metabarcoding of 419 fecal samples collected over 1 year, we characterized and compared the diets of four Trachypithecus species from rainforest and limestone habitats in Vietnam. The Effect of Risk Perception on Behavior Towards “Untact” Tourism in Vietnam
ABSTRACT Untact services have gained popularity across several areas of tourism as a fruitful strategy for companies in the recovery of tourism after the pandemic's outbreak. The notion of untact service denotes services in which consumers can avoid physical interactions thanks to advances in digital technologies.
